About Siham Tabik
Siham Tabik is a scholar working on Computer Vision and Pattern Recognition, Artificial Intelligence, Ecology, Media Technology and Atmospheric Science, having authored 70 papers that have together received 8.9k indexed citations. Recurring topics across this work include Remote Sensing in Agriculture (12 papers), Remote-Sensing Image Classification (9 papers), Remote Sensing and LiDAR Applications (8 papers), Parallel Computing and Optimization Techniques (6 papers), Robotics and Sensor-Based Localization (5 papers), Anomaly Detection Techniques and Applications (5 papers), Advanced Neural Network Applications (5 papers) and Species Distribution and Climate Change (5 papers). The work is most often cited by research in Health Informatics (825 citations), Artificial Intelligence (4.5k citations), Safety Research (795 citations), Computer Vision and Pattern Recognition (1.5k citations) and Health Information Management (200 citations). Siham Tabik has collaborated with scholars based in Spain, Morocco and United States. Frequent co-authors include Francisco Herrera, Adrien Bennetot, Richard Benjamins, Salvador García, Raja Chatila, Daniel Molina, Sergio Gil-López, Natalia Díaz-Rodríguez, Javier Del Ser and Alberto Barbado. Their work appears in journals such as Neurocomputing, Information Fusion, IEEE Journal of Selected Topics in Applied Earth Observations and Remote Sensing, Remote Sensing and Computer Physics Communications.
